Title: David P. Prince: Innovator in Electronic Substrate Imaging

Introduction

David P. Prince, an inventive mind based in Wakefield, Rhode Island, is recognized for his contributions to the field of imaging systems for electronic substrates. With a total of 10 patents to his name, his work focuses on enhancing the precision and efficiency of material applications through innovative imaging techniques.

Latest Patents

David's most recent patents include groundbreaking technologies such as the "Color-Based Linear Three Dimensional Acquisition System and Method." This invention involves a sophisticated imaging system designed to capture three-dimensional image data critical for inspecting and aligning electronic substrates. The system utilizes a unique illumination assembly that projects light at an angle to the substrate surface, allowing for detailed imaging facilitated by an advanced image sensor assembly.

Another significant patent is the "Single and Multi-Spectral Illumination System and Method." This invention pertains to a stencil printer apparatus that effectively deposits solder paste onto electronic substrates. The apparatus is integrated with an imaging system that captures images of the substrate while a controller orchestrates its movement, ensuring accurate application of materials while utilizing long-wavelength light for illumination.
